mirror of
https://gitee.com/openharmony/print_print_fwk
synced 2024-11-23 08:59:47 +00:00
add print tdd
Signed-off-by: chuangda_1 <fangwanning@huawei.com>
This commit is contained in:
parent
89d7c51622
commit
ceeb5b1bb7
@ -17,9 +17,9 @@
|
||||
#define PRINT_PAGESIZE_H
|
||||
#define TDD_ENABLE 1
|
||||
|
||||
#include <map>
|
||||
#include "napi/native_api.h"
|
||||
#include "parcel.h"
|
||||
#include <map>
|
||||
|
||||
namespace OHOS::Print {
|
||||
enum PageSizeId {
|
||||
|
@ -13,15 +13,15 @@
|
||||
* limitations under the License.
|
||||
*/
|
||||
|
||||
#include <gtest/gtest.h>
|
||||
#include "napi/native_api.h"
|
||||
#include "print_extension_info.h"
|
||||
#include <gtest/gtest.h>
|
||||
|
||||
using namespace testing::ext;
|
||||
|
||||
namespace OHOS {
|
||||
namespace Print {
|
||||
class PrinterInfoTest : public testing::Test {
|
||||
class PrintExtensionInfoTest : public testing::Test {
|
||||
public:
|
||||
static void SetUpTestCase(void);
|
||||
static void TearDownTestCase(void);
|
||||
|
@ -13,10 +13,10 @@
|
||||
* limitations under the License.
|
||||
*/
|
||||
|
||||
#include <gtest/gtest.h>
|
||||
#include "napi/native_api.h"
|
||||
#include "print_job.h"
|
||||
#include "print_page_size.h"
|
||||
#include <gtest/gtest.h>
|
||||
|
||||
using namespace testing::ext;
|
||||
|
||||
@ -265,6 +265,7 @@ HWTEST_F(PrintJobTest, PrintJobTest_0017, TestSize.Level1)
|
||||
job.SetJobState(4);
|
||||
job.SetSubState(2);
|
||||
EXPECT_EQ(2, job.GetSubState());
|
||||
}
|
||||
|
||||
/**
|
||||
* @tc.name: PrintJobTest_0018
|
||||
|
@ -133,8 +133,16 @@ HWTEST_F(PrintMarginTest, PrintMarginTest_007, TestSize.Level1)
|
||||
HWTEST_F(PrintMarginTest, PrintMarginTest_008, TestSize.Level1)
|
||||
{
|
||||
OHOS::Print::PrintMargin margin;
|
||||
napi_env env = nullptr;
|
||||
margin.Reset();
|
||||
EXPECT_EQ(0, margin.GetRight());
|
||||
OHOS::Print::PrintMargin(margin) margin_;
|
||||
margin.SetTop(1);
|
||||
margin.SetLeft(2);
|
||||
margin.SetRight(3);
|
||||
margin.SetBottom(4);
|
||||
margin.ToJsObject(env);
|
||||
margin.Dump();
|
||||
}
|
||||
} // namespace Print
|
||||
} // namespace OHOS
|
@ -200,5 +200,5 @@ HWTEST_F(NapiPrintUtilTest, NapiPrintUtilTest_0009, TestSize.Level1)
|
||||
OHOS::Print::NapiPrintUtils::DecodeExtensionCid(cid, extensionId, callbackId);
|
||||
OHOS::Print::NapiPrintUtils::DecodeExtensionCid(cid, extensionId_err, callbackId);
|
||||
}
|
||||
}// namespace Print
|
||||
} // namespace Print
|
||||
} // namespace OHOS
|
||||
|
@ -53,11 +53,11 @@ void PrintManagerClientTest::TearDown(void) {}
|
||||
*/
|
||||
HWTEST_F(PrintManagerClientTest, PrintManagerClientTest_0001, TestSize.Level1)
|
||||
{
|
||||
OHOS::Print::PrintManagerClient Testclient;
|
||||
OHOS::Print::PrintManagerClient Testclient;
|
||||
std::vector<std::string> fileList = {"datashare://data/print/a.png",
|
||||
"datashare://data/print/b.png", "datashare://data/print/c.png"};
|
||||
std::vector<uint32_t> fdList = {1, 2};
|
||||
std::string taskId = "2";
|
||||
std::string taskId = "2";
|
||||
PrintExtensionInfo printExtensionInfo;
|
||||
printExtensionInfo.SetExtensionId("1");
|
||||
printExtensionInfo.SetVendorIcon(1);
|
||||
@ -65,7 +65,7 @@ HWTEST_F(PrintManagerClientTest, PrintManagerClientTest_0001, TestSize.Level1)
|
||||
printExtensionInfo.SetExtensionId("1");
|
||||
printExtensionInfo.SetVendorId("1");
|
||||
std::vector<PrintExtensionInfo> extensionInfos;
|
||||
extensionInfos.emplace_back(printExtensionInfo);
|
||||
extensionInfos.emplace_back(printExtensionInfo);
|
||||
Testclient.StartPrint(fileList, fdList, taskId);
|
||||
Testclient.QueryAllExtension(extensionInfos);
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user